Xbox One to Feature Remote Play via Skype?

Though again, Microsoft is tight-lipped about the feature.

Remote play is becoming a pretty important feature for the next generation of consoles, like the PlayStation Vita’s ability to play PS4 games on the go. However, it seems that the Xbox One will also have that feature.

As Polygon noted, during a demonstration of Skype for the Xbox One, it seemed that the player on the receiving end could join in and take over from the other player, while the latter watches. Given how Skype for Xbox One is trying to encourage players to cooperate with each other, it seems like the perfect feature.

However, Microsoft didn’t confirm the same. “In the days since we announced Xbox One there has been a lot of random speculation about various features and potential future scenarios for Xbox One. We look forward to sharing more details at a later date, but aren’t discussing anything further at this time.”

The Xbox One is set to release at the end of 2013.
